The rise of Chinese lab Moonshot’s open-weight model Kimi K3 has sparked debate over whether the U.S. government should restrict advanced Chinese AI models, following reports that the Trump administration is considering such a move at the urging of American frontier labs. OpenAI’s Dean W. Ball had suggested regulatory action against open-weight models before retracting the claim amid criticism from figures including Yann LeCun and Martin Casado.
Advocates argue open-weight models expand access to AI innovation rather than threatening it. Braden Hancock of Snorkel AI said strong open-source models pressure frontier companies’ margins but expand overall AI adoption, comparing their potential impact to that of open-source software like PyTorch. Hugging Face CEO Clem Delanguewarned that restricting open models would concentrate power rather than improve safety.
Concerns cited by critics include data security, embedded bias, and weaker safety guardrails, though researchers say evidence supporting these risks remains limited. Sam Bresnick of Georgetown’s Center for Security and Emerging Technology said chip export controls, rather than banning open-weight models, would more effectively preserve U.S. AI leadership. He added that both open and proprietary AI business models remain financially unresolved, a challenge mirrored within China’s own AI industry.
